Transaction 8872573ffe695bcf67d1c97f79c9ad4bed76a72e90f0a40bfcf4e424a4867597

1 Input
2 Outputs
  • 8872573ffe695bcf67d1c97f79c9ad4bed76a72e90f0a40bfcf4e424a4867597:0
  • value  695386
    address  18EJm1ZeLfBt3PrG1HsBVjqW5kq8XrSeqC
  • 8872573ffe695bcf67d1c97f79c9ad4bed76a72e90f0a40bfcf4e424a4867597:1
  • value  550000
    address  1BgTCsNtC46wt6KrdU1y67QHB1onajQMTA